Description

Written by an international group of master interventionists, this volume is a comprehensive, step-by-step guide to coronary and non-coronary endovascular techniques. After a review of vascular pathoanatomy, vascular pathophysiology, and peri-interventional diagnostics, the book details the principles and techniques of endovascular interventions in all vascular territories. Chapters cover intracranial vessels, internal carotid artery, coronary arteries, thoracic aorta, abdominal aortic aneurysm, renal arteries, iliac and lower extremity arteries, hemodialysis shunts, venous diseases, and foreign bodies. The authors offer guidelines on the choice of instrumentation and the decision-making process at each step of the intervention. More than 1,000 illustrations demonstrate the techniques.
